The following information is available for Novak Corporation for 2020, 1 2 3. CCA that was reported on the 2020 tax return exceeded depreciation reported on the income statement by $156,800. This difference is expected to reverse in equal amounts of $39.200 per year over the period 2021 to 2024. Dividends received from taxable Canadian corporations were $22,540 Rent collected in advance on January 1, 2020 totalled $88.200 for a three-year period. Of this amount, $58,800 was reported as unearned for book purposes at December 31, 2020 The tax rates are 25% for 2020 and 30% for 2021 and subsequent years. Income taxes payable are $196,000 for 2020. 4. 5. Calculate taxable income. Taxable income $ e Textbook and Media Calculate accounting income for 2020. Accounting income for 2020 $
